fraid o clowns wrote:
Edit: I looked at the rebate form but I'm still confused. Do I need to buy 3 items that are on that list in order to get $300 off and then I get to choose where I apply the rebate?


For example, let's say I buy a 300D and a 16-35. This would get me double rebates on both ($200 for the 300D, $100 for the 16-35) for a total of $300 back from Canon.

If I bought a 300D, 16-35, and 70-200 IS, I would get back $600 from Canon ($300 for the 300D, $150 for the 16-35, $150 for the 70-200 IS). Make sense?
